14 reminders · core list always includedCore safety and essentials
Wearable, properly fitted U.S. Coast Guard-approved life jacket for every person
Current weather and water conditions checked shortly before leaving
Route, access, landowner permission, known hazards, and return plan verified through current responsible sources
Trip plan and expected return time shared with a dependable person who is not on the trip
Charged phone in waterproof protection, with a plan for reaching 911 when needed
Enough drinking water and food for the outing, plus a reasonable reserve
First-aid kit and any personal medications
Sun protection and a complete dry change of clothes
Trash bag so everything brought in can be packed out
Paddling
Paddle for each paddler and a spare when practical
Sound-producing device and every other item currently required for the vessel
Boat, drain plug, straps, tie-downs, and launch and recovery plan checked before departure
Essential clothing, keys, and emergency supplies secured in waterproof protection
Group skills and rescue plan matched to current water, weather, obstacles, and distance
